@tjw08....yours is an cyanaguttatus and mine is carpintis, two different strains of herichthys sp.
your fish has more of olive green-brown pearls(the spots on body)
mine has green-bluish colored pearls, they actually reflect green if light falls from front and blue from top...

Scratanut, your Escondido is gorgeous!! Do anyone knows how to tell the difference between a male and female? Is that a male or female?
 
Cichlidfever;2999328; said:
Scratanut, your Escondido is gorgeous!! Do anyone knows how to tell the difference between a male and female? Is that a male or female?

Thanks!
Healthy females are a little plumpy(when compared to males), with a black blotch at the base of dorsal fin.
BTW mine is not an escondido.
